Anupama 17th March 2025 Written Update: Rahi’s first festive. Today in Anupama written update, the episode kicks off with Meeta teasing that Rahi will now discipline her brothers-in-law with a stick. Badshah, being the self-proclaimed young one, declares immunity, while Raja brags about his bouquet gift as a shield. But Rahi, on a mission, chases both of them down like a Bollywood action hero—only to mistakenly whack Gautam. Ansh anticipates major drama, but surprise, surprise—Gautam laughs it off, successfully diffusing the tension. Even Rahi is left bewildered by his unexpected reaction. Meanwhile, Anupama, always ready to worry over the tiniest things, starts fretting about Rahi’s cooking skills. She’s convinced that the poor girl, new to the Kothari household, will be left alone to wrestle with a spatula and spices.

As Rahi contemplates calling Anupama for help, Anupama is already on standby, eagerly waiting for the call like a mother monitoring her child’s first day at school. But before she can dial, Rahi decides to take the traditional approach—prayer. Vasundhara, always looking for a reason to be impressed or judge, is pleased by Rahi’s devotion and vows to stick around in the kitchen like a watchdog. Meanwhile, Prem, ever the supportive husband, tries to step in, but Vasundhara blocks him faster than a traffic cop, declaring that this is a solo mission. To add more pressure, she asks Rahi to cook for Lord Krishna. Great. First-time cooking and divine expectations—no pressure at all.

Back in Worry Central, Anupama is still pacing. Leela suggests she call Rahi, probably just to get her to calm down. Anupama checks in, but before Rahi can say much, Vasundhara intercepts, declaring that Rahi must focus on her task, basically putting Anupama on a timeout. She’s ready to test Rahi’s cooking skills and won’t tolerate outside interference.

Faced with a crisis, Rahi resorts to modern-day cheat codes—earphones. With Anupama and Prem’s expert coaching, she navigates the culinary battlefield. But Vasundhara, ever the detective, senses something’s off. Khyati busts Rahi mid-call, adding a sprinkle of guilt to her already nerve-wracking experience. Feeling like a cheater in a board game, Rahi apologizes to God and solemnly swears to learn proper cooking next time. Meeta then nudges Rahi and Prem to make a wish, and, of course, they wish for their admission. Vasundhara, the resident dream-crusher, ominously declares that their wish won’t be granted. Talk about spreading positive vibes.

Meanwhile, in the nostalgia corner, Anupama reminisces with Hasmuk about the good old days when he used to help her. Hasmuk, ever the wise old owl, reassures her that Prem and Rahi will support each other just like they did. Then, shifting gears, he casually asks about her “central jail deal”—because, you know, discussing prison contracts is normal small talk. Right on cue, the commissioner calls Anupama, offering her the chance to cook for inmates on Holi. Anupama, ever the multitasker, is thrilled at the opportunity to whip up some festive prison cuisine.

Back in the Kothari household, Vasundhara decides that Rahi will serve the food, continuing the “let’s-test-Rahi” saga. Prem, like the doting husband he is, steps in to help. Shockingly, the Kotharis shower praise on Rahi’s cooking skills, meaning her secret coaching session paid off. Vasundhara then switches the topic to the Holi celebration, pulling the ultimate gatekeeper move by declaring that Rahi can’t go to the Shah house. Prem, not one to let things slide, immediately asks if she invited the Shahs. Vasundhara deflects and instead tells Prem to start Holi preparations. Classic avoidance tactic.

Meanwhile, Rahi and Prem are buzzing with excitement about going to Mumbai, but Parag, always the party pooper, expresses his doubts. He doesn’t trust Vasundhara, and frankly, neither should anyone else at this point. Meanwhile, at the Shah house, Anupama learns that Rahi will be joining the Holi ritual, prompting Leela to unleash a fresh round of drama. As usual, Holi prep discussions ensue, but amidst all the chaos, Anupama finds herself missing Anuj.

Precap: Holi celebrations are in full swing with the Shahs and the Kotharis. Anupama heads to jail, where Raghav insists he’s not a murderer (cue dramatic tension). Meanwhile, Rahi and Prem make a shocking discovery—their admission letter was sent ages ago. Uh-oh. Someone’s been playing games.
